Choosing the Right Shotgun Light: A Buyer’s Guide

What Makes a Good Shotgun Light?

A good shotgun light helps you see in the dark. It makes your shotgun more useful for hunting, self-defense, or just for fun. We will look at what you need to know before you buy one.

Key Features to Look For

  • Brightness (Lumens): This is how bright the light is. More lumens mean a brighter light. For a shotgun light, you want something bright enough to see far away. Look for at least 500 lumens, but 800-1000 lumens is even better.
  • Beam Type: Some lights have a focused beam that goes a long way. Others have a wider beam that lights up a bigger area close by. Think about what you will use it for. A focused beam is good for spotting targets far away. A wider beam is good for seeing everything around you.
  • Strobe Mode: This feature makes the light flash quickly. It can surprise or disorient someone. It is a good feature for self-defense.
  • Mounting System: How does the light attach to your shotgun? It needs to be secure and easy to put on and take off. Many lights use rails, which are common on modern shotguns.
  • Battery Life: How long does the battery last? You don’t want the light to die when you need it most. Check how long it runs on its brightest setting.
  • Durability: Shotgun lights can get bumped around. They need to be tough.

Important Materials

Shotgun lights are usually made from strong materials.

  • Aluminum: Many lights use aircraft-grade aluminum. This is strong but also light. It can handle bumps and drops.
  • Polymer: Some parts might be made of strong plastic, called polymer. This can make the light lighter and cheaper.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

What makes a shotgun light good or not so good?

  • Build Quality: How well is the light made? Are there any loose parts? A well-built light will last longer.
  • Water Resistance: Will it work if it gets wet? Look for lights with a good water-resistance rating, like IPX4 or higher.
  • Heat Management: Bright lights can get hot. Good lights have ways to cool down so they don’t overheat.
  • Brand Reputation: Some brands are known for making good quality lights. Reading reviews from other users can help you choose a reliable brand.
  • Price: While you don’t always need the most expensive light, very cheap lights might not be as bright or as durable.

User Experience and Use Cases

How do people use shotgun lights?

  • Home Defense: A light helps you identify threats in low light. It can also startle intruders.
  • Hunting: Some hunters use lights to find game at dawn or dusk.
  • Sport Shooting: For some shooting sports, a light can help with aiming or seeing targets in indoor ranges or at night.
  • Tactical Use: Law enforcement and military personnel use lights for their operations.

A good user experience means the light is easy to turn on and off, the controls are simple, and it stays put on your shotgun. It should not get in the way of you using your firearm safely.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What is the best brightness for a shotgun light?

A: For most uses, 500 to 1000 lumens is a good range. This gives you enough brightness to see clearly at a reasonable distance.

Q: How do I attach a shotgun light?

A: Most lights attach to a rail system on your shotgun. Make sure your shotgun has a rail or you can add one.

Q: Can I use any flashlight on my shotgun?

A: No, it is best to use a light made for firearms. These are built to be tough and have a secure mounting system.

Q: Does a strobe mode really help?

A: Yes, the flashing light can confuse or disorient someone, which can be helpful in a self-defense situation.

Q: How long should the battery last?

A: Look for lights that can run for at least an hour on their brightest setting. Rechargeable batteries are often a good choice.

Q: Are shotgun lights waterproof?

A: Many are water-resistant, meaning they can handle rain or splashes. Check the product’s water-resistance rating.

Q: What is the difference between a focused beam and a wide beam?

A: A focused beam shoots light a long way in a narrow path. A wide beam lights up a larger area closer to you.

Q: Is it legal to put a light on my shotgun?

A: In most places, it is legal. However, it is always a good idea to check your local laws.

Q: How much should I expect to spend on a good shotgun light?

A: You can find decent lights for around $50-$100, but higher-quality, more powerful lights can cost $150 or more.

Q: How do I maintain my shotgun light?

A: Keep the lens clean and replace the batteries when needed. Store it in a dry place.
